The job-hop raise shrank. For diaspora households, vesting and visas decide the rest.

ADP’s August Pay Insights still show switchers out-earning stayers on gross pay, 7.3% to 4.4%. That gap is a fraction of the Great Resignation peak. For Asian first-gen tech and consulting workers, unvested RSUs, H-1B clocks, and AI mid-career cuts often outweigh a few points of raise.
